![]() Observing Quality of Life in DementiaMather LifeWays Institute on Aging’s Observing Quality of Life in Dementia (OQOLD) Training Toolkit is designed to help researchers and practitioners assess systematically the quality of life of people with memory problems. OQOLD is a reliable, valid, and practical procedure that was developed during a six-year time period in collaboration with service providers in adult day care, assisted living, and skilled care. During these six years, OQOLD researchers worked closely with staff to ensure the final product would be both practical and useful.
